Last week, we worked through some generational distinctives and effective methods for equipping members of Gen Z and Gen Alpha to share and live out their faith. This week, we focus in on the area of Christian citizenship and hear from a member of Gen Z engaged in public life. In this episode, guest Birjan Crispin shares his remarkable story that began in a Bulgarian orphanage, how he became a follower of Jesus, and how God led him to impact the public square. We also discuss the spiritual condition of Gen Z, how Gen Z thinks about the church and its role in public life, and how ministries can effectively disciple the next generation in the area of Christian citizenship.
Birjan Crispin is the Deputy Director of The Good Citizen Project, a Hope College graduate (’20) – B.A. Business & Political Science, a former legislative aide with the Indiana House Republican Caucus, graduate of the Heritage Foundation’s Leadership Fellowship Academy, the Leadership Institute’s Young Leaders Program, and Indiana Family Institute’s Hoosier Leadership Series Class of 2024. He is also a speaker and author.
